镇江长江500kV大跨越北塔塔高180m,钢结构,由意大利SAE公司设计。地基分析和基础处理由SAE公司委托意大利岩土工程研究所负责。地质资料由能源部华东电力设计院提供。北岸跨越塔和耐张塔均位于第四纪近代长江冲积层之上,地层由软可塑的亚粘土、轻亚粘土和粉砂组成。塔位所在地区的地震基本烈度为7°,考虑到本工程的重要性,经国家计委审查批准抗震设防烈度为8°。
Zhenjiang Changjiang 500kV spanning 180 meters north tower, steel structure, designed by the Italian SAE company. Ground-based analysis and basic treatment were entrusted by SAE to the Italian Institute of Geotechnical Engineering. Geological data is provided by East China Electric Power Design Institute of the Ministry of Energy. The north bank crossing tower and the tension tower are all located on the alluvial layers of the Yangtze River in the Quaternary period. The formation consists of soft clay subclay, light sub-clay and silt. The earthquake intensity in the area where the tower is located is 7°. Considering the importance of this project, the intensity of seismic fortification is 8° after review and approval by the State Planning Commission.
